Job Description

The Laboratory Technician primarily supports analysis of bulk samples using PLM for asbestos, and analysis of non-culturable surface and air samples for fungi.  Laboratory Technician/Assistant prepares and analyzes environmental samples according to scientific methodology in compliance with company Quality Assurance programs and SOP’s, and must be knowledgeable of both job-specific routine and complex analyses. The Laboratory Technician/Assistant assists with validating and reviewing data for accuracy, and enters laboratory data into the LIMS that ultimately generates required reports to clients. Schedules sample workload according to due dates and sample hold times, and must be knowledgeable of the job-specific laboratory testing equipment, requiring the exercise of discretion and judgment in its operation.
